ARTISTS TRANSFORM HISTORIC BARN INTO
UNIQUE ART INSTALLATION,CONCATENATION
One-Day Exhibit Features Work by Daniel Rossi and Dymphna de Wild
STAUNTON, VA – An innovative art installation, CONCATENATION, will be hosted in an unlikely site certain to challenge the traditional art-going experience. Virginia-based Italian artist, Daniel Rossi and Dutch artist, Dymphna de Wild will create site-specific installations in the transformed barn on historic Cobble Hill Farm in Staunton, Virginia. The barn will be converted into a one-of-a-kind art experience for one day only, Sunday, October 28th from 3PM – 8PM.
Concatenation is defined as “a series of events, ideas or things that are connected.”
The installation explores the concept of chain reactions and its relevance in our lives. Rossi and de Wild will feature large-scale mobiles; mixed media and illuminated sculptures; abstract paintings; and works on paper. Through an immersive environment, CONCATENATION presents the infinity of possible scenarios, linked between past, present and future.
The artist-organized installation is an exploratory step in redefining how the public encounters the arts. By constructing an exhibit in an unconventional space, artists explore the possibilities in terms of creative process. In turn, it can be a powerful platform for reaching a broader audience.
Daniel Rossi studied at the International School of Illustration in Rome, Italy. His work has been exhibited in New York, NY, Brooklyn Arts Council, Agora Gallery, 3rd Ward, Brooklyn Public Library; Washington, D.C. Martin Luther King Pubic Library, Capricorno Gallery, Inter-American Development Bank; Guatemala City, Guatemala Italian Cultural Institute; Perugia, Italy, Villa Fidelia di Spello, as well as in Brazil and numerous other international solo- and group-shows. www.rossiprojects.com
Dymphna de Wild received her MFA from James Madison University and earned her BFA from the Corcoran College of Art and Design in Washington, DC. Her work has been exhibited in Soldotna, Alaska, The Gary Freeburg Art Gallery; Harrisonburg, VA, Sawhill Gallery, New Image Gallery, and Darrin-McHone Gallery; Charlottesville, VA, Second Street Gallery; Richmond, VA, Capital One; Staunton, VA, Beverley Street Studio School Gallery; Lynchburg, VA, Academy of Fine Arts, as well as in Spain, the Netherlands, and Belgium. She will participate in a group show at Five Myles Gallery, Brooklyn, NY which will open November 17. Dymphna de Wild teaches at James Madison University, at the Governor’s School, and at the Beverley Street Studio School in Staunton, VA. www.dymphdewild.com

ABOUT. This exhibition explores the relationship of language and the visual arts. Through paintings, illustrations, photography, sculpture, installations, video, performance and new-media, BABEL establishes connections between the written word and the recent explosion of immigrant conclaves in and around New York City. Selected works treat the diversity and plurality of the written language as reflected, incorporated, and/or appropriated in visual arts, performance, and the moving image.

Synopsis
Dario, an unsuccessful script-writer, last initiate of a “beat generation” printed only on the posters and brought back to life by the lines of a book, tries the profession of author of educational cartoons. In the company where he is employed he will soon meet the producer, Ivan, an authoritarian man with a personality far too strong, and made up in order to hide his homosexuality and his desire for transgression. Dario will become a friend of Gary, a dwarf leading a mediocre and trivial life, always devoted to his employer, the same Ivan of the cartoons’ production house. Brought up by Ivan, Gary will become for Dario his alter ego, the voice of conscience that warns him and pushes him to obey time, the due dates, the paces, the trends and the ways the society imposes on men to give them “peaceful” living together. Dario’s professional apprenticeship coincides with his sentimental one: first, madly in love with Eva, a beautiful girl with a dark and mysterious past, divided between the being and the seeming. One day, under Ivan’s constant influence Dario decides to break up with that same girl that once had told him about the Time of emotions, which disdains clock hands and tolls and knows only a sound, the heart’s sound.
